Your Smile
Loneliness visits
when stranded alone
Confirming the emptiness
—lost to bemoan
The darker the moment
the thicker it spreads
To lie and to cover
—my spirit in dread
It blocks every motion
I make to get out
Its shroud to enshadow
—within and without
As somber it tenants
it knows all the while
Its life but a memory
—the moment you smile
(Dreamsleep: May, 2022)
